Item 5.02. |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ers. |
On January 20, 2009, John W. Handy informed the Company that he would retire from his position as Executive Vice President of Horizon Lines, Inc. (the “Company”), and from all other positions he held with the Company and its subsidiaries, effective January 31, 2009. In connection with Mr. Handy’s retirement, the Company and Mr. Handy entered into a Retirement Agreement and a Consulting Agreement on January 21, 2009.
The Retirement Agreement provides certain benefits to Mr. Handy in recognition of his past services to the Company and in consideration for his consent to certain post-termination obligations and a release of claims. These benefits consist of a single lump-sum cash payment of $388,881; full vesting on January 31, 2009 of 70,000 shares of restricted stock which were otherwise scheduled to vest on February 1, 2011; payment of approximately $19,000 on January 31, 2009 for accrued but unpaid dividends on a portion of the 70,000 shares of restricted stock (plus earnings on those accrued dividends); and full and immediate vesting on January 31, 2009 of the following stock option awards and extension of the period of exercise of those stock options until their original expiration dates:
Option Grant | Number of Stock | Option Exercise | Option Expiration | |||
Date | Options | Price | Date | |||
4/07/2006 | 60,000 | $12.54 | 4/07/2016 | |||
3/26/2007 | 20,000 | $33.51 | 3/26/2017 | |||
4/24/2008 | 15,000 | $14.63 | 4/24/2021 |
Mr. Handy also will receive benefits generally available to all Company employees under various Company benefit plans.
The post-termination obligations relate to non-competition, non-solicitation, non-disparagement, confidentiality and cooperation with the Company in connection with certain matters that may arise following his termination of employment. The non-competition and non-solicitation restrictions apply for one year following Mr. Handy’s retirement.
A copy of the Retirement Agreement is attached hereto as Exhibit 10.1 and is incorporated herein by reference.
Under the Consulting Agreement, Mr. Handy has agreed to provide certain consulting services to the Company through December 31, 2010. In consideration for performance of these services, Mr. Handy will receive a quarterly fee of $10,000 and reimbursement for all reasonable direct business expenses incurred. The Consulting Agreement also contains a non-competition clause that applies for one year following the termination of the Consulting Agreement.
A copy of the Consulting Agreement is attached hereto as Exhibit 10.2 and is incorporated herein by reference.
The foregoing descriptions do not constitute complete summaries of the Retirement Agreement or the Consulting Agreement. Reference is made to the complete text of each agreement, which are attached hereto as Exhibits 10.1 and 10.2, respectively, and are incorporated herein by reference.
